Abstract
1403091 Sludge removal from separation tanks PATERSON CANDY INTERNATIONAL Ltd 3 Sept 1973 [26 Sept 1972] 44449/72 Heading C1C A solid-liquid separation tank containing a sludge hopper with its inlet level coinciding with the intended surface level of a fluidized blanket in the tank and supported by an arrangement which responds when the combined weight of the hopper and its contents exceeds a first predetermined value by initiating discharge of the hopper contents via an outlet until the hopper weight is reduced to a second predetermined value, is described. Theapparatus described with reference to the drawing shows the hopper 36 having a flexible hose 38 for discharge of contents by valve 41. As the weight of the hopper increases the lever 43 operates switch 49 and valve 41 is opened. When the weight decreases to a predetermined level the switch is disengaged.
